CONTEXT & BACKGROUND

INDUSTRY

Enterprise SaaS / Engineering Intelligence

WHY THIS MATTERS

Cubyts is an enterprise SaaS platform used to improve engineering quality, visibility, and governance. As adoption grew, feature velocity increased but structural clarity did not scale with it. The product wasn't broken. It was becoming heavy. Reporting was dense but not decisive. PR workflows were functional but fragmented. Governance systems were powerful but cognitively expensive. The risk wasn't usability the risk was long-term scalability.

GAPS IN EXISTING SOLUTIONS

  • Reporting surfaces exposed data without enabling decisions

  • PR review workflows caused context loss and screen-switching fatigue

  • Governance configuration was powerful but created cognitive overload

  • No structural cohesion across 15+ feature enhancements

KEY INSIGHTS

What the research revealed

01

INSIGHT

Data without hierarchy is noise

WHY

Leaders had access to all metrics but couldn't identify what required action

DESIGN IMPLICATION

Restructure reporting into a signal hierarchy surface what needs attention first

02

INSIGHT

Context loss is the invisible tax on developer productivity

WHY

PR reviewers spent more time re-establishing context than actually reviewing

DESIGN IMPLICATION

Persistent, inline contextual panels eliminate the need for screen-switching

03

INSIGHT

Configuration power needs structural guardrails

WHY

Admins avoided using powerful features out of fear of creating inconsistencies

DESIGN IMPLICATION

Wizard-based flows and explicit dependency visibility reduce configuration anxiety

KEY SCREENS

Design solutions

PR Review - Contextual RHS Panel


PROBLEM

PR reviews required screen-switching, causing constant context loss in high-volume environments

SOLUTION

Persistent inline right-hand panel surfaces specific code flaw details without leaving the review flow

PRD to Execution Workflow

PROBLEM

PRD workflows were fragmented across tools, making it hard to structure tasks, track updates, and maintain clarity leading to misalignment and missed changes.

SOLUTION

A centralized AI workspace that converts PRDs into structured tasks, with real-time updates, comparisons, and version tracking for seamless execution.

Solution PR & Audit Log

PROBLEM

Merge state progression was ambiguous and audit trails were inconsistent across review workflows

SOLUTION

Structured action history logs with standardized resolution states and audit-level transparency

Issue Deduplication Flow

PROBLEM

Duplicate issue creation when flags reappeared caused noise in the tracking system

SOLUTION

Conditional logic detects existing issues and presents a clear merge or update path instead

Bitbucket Integration

PROBLEM

Cross-platform state synchronization was unpredictable, causing merge feedback loop failures

SOLUTION

Structured credential inputs and clear state synchronization signals shifted the integration from reactive to reliable

WHAT I LEARNED

Enterprise complexity demands architectural thinking, isolated redesigns create new fragmentation

Signal hierarchy is a design problem, not a data problem - the same information can paralyze or empower

Configuration systems need structural guardrails as much as creative freedom

WHAT I'D DO DIFFERENTLY

Would establish shared design principles earlier to align across squads faster

Could have introduced governance layer documentation to reduce stakeholder alignment overhead

Accessibility audit should be part of the initial design framework, not a later review
